The young goalkeeper of the Spanish “Leganesa” Andrei Lunin, whose rights belong to the Madrid “Real”, went down in history. Examples.

19-year-old goalkeeper became the youngest Ukrainian who played in La Liga. Lunin's debut in Spain's top division took place on November 10, when his Leganes met in the 12th round of the domestic championship against Girona.

Andrey started the fight from the bench, but got his chance on the 84th minute. The main goalkeeper guests Ivan Cuellar was injured and it was replaced by the Ukrainian goalkeeper.. This game was the second for Lunin for "Leganes". Earlier, the Ukrainian made his debut for the club in the match of the 1/16 finals of the Spanish Cup against Rayo Vallecano.

Interestingly, the last record belonged to the ex-defender of “Barcelona” Dmitry Chigrinsky, who at the time of the first game for the Catalans was 22 years old.

As for the match between “Leganes” and “Girona”, the teams failed to identify the winner, drawing in a draw - 0: 0.
